12 It has[a] a great and high wall that has twelve gates, and at the gates twelve angels, and names written on the gates which are[b] of the twelve tribes of the sons of Israel— 13 on the east, three gates, and on the north, three gates, and on the south, three gates, and on the west, three gates. 14 And the wall of the city has twelve foundations, and on them are twelve names of the twelve apostles of the Lamb.

12 It had a great, high wall with twelve gates,(A) and with twelve angels at the gates. On the gates were written the names of the twelve tribes of Israel.(B) 13 There were three gates on the east, three on the north, three on the south and three on the west. 14 The wall of the city had twelve foundations,(C) and on them were the names of the twelve apostles(D) of the Lamb.
